Lineage II: The Chaotic Chronicle

Lineage II is a groundbreaking fantasy MMORPG that plunges you into the sprawling, fully 3D realms of Aden, Elmore, and Gracia. Choose from a variety of class types and join forces with fellow adventurers to form powerful clans, strategize epic castle sieges, and claim your place in a living, breathing world where every battle and alliance matters. With stunning graphics and seamless real-time combat, it’s never been more thrilling to carve out your legend.

As a prequel to the original Lineage saga, this epic adventure invites you to select one of five distinct races—Human, Orc, Elf, Dark Elf, or Dwarf—and embark on quest- and item-driven journeys that will test your wits and courage. Powered by the innovative Synchronized Tactical Combat System, every encounter demands skill and teamwork, while the unique taming system lets you befriend creatures from loyal hounds to mighty dragons. Whether you’re storming enemy fortresses or exploring hidden dungeons, Lineage II offers limitless replayability and unparalleled excitement.

Gameplay

Lineage II: The Chaotic Chronicle delivers a robust MMORPG experience by offering a variety of class types and a deep character‐customization system. Players start by choosing from five distinct races—Human, Orc, Elf, Dark Elf, and Dwarf—each with unique strengths and questlines. Progression feels meaningful as you unlock new skills, traits, and equipment that cater to diverse playstyles, whether you prefer close‐quarters combat or long‐range spellcasting.

The synchronized tactical combat system is a standout feature, shifting away from traditional tab‐targeting. Real‐time movement, skill chaining, and position‐based attacks reward players who master timing and teamwork. This approach ensures that even routine encounters retain a sense of dynamism, as you dodge enemy spells, counterattack at the right moment, and coordinate crowd control with party members.

Clans and sieges are at the heart of Lineage II’s endgame. Forming or joining a clan unlocks large‐scale castle sieges where strategy, diplomacy, and timing determine dominance. These epic battles can involve dozens, if not hundreds, of players in a single server, forging alliances and rivalries that keep the world feeling alive and competitive.

Complementing PvP and dungeon crawling is a rich taming system. From loyal hounds to majestic dragons, your ability to capture and train creatures introduces an additional layer to both solo and group play. Tamed beasts not only assist in combat but can also be leveled, equipped, and even bred, adding a long‐term progression path for players who enjoy pet management alongside traditional adventuring.

Graphics

The Chaotic Chronicle builds upon Lineage II’s fully 3D engine to deliver sweeping vistas and detailed character models. From the sunlit ramparts of Aden Castle to the misty forests of Gracia, each region is crafted with care, offering a sense of scale that draws you into the world. Seasonal and day/night cycles further enhance immersion, altering lighting and mood as you traverse each area.

Character and monster animations feel fluid, whether you’re performing a powerful two‐handed swing or unleashing an elaborate spell effect. Equipment changes are reflected instantly on your avatar, making the loot grind visually satisfying. Armor pieces gleam in sunlight, and battle scars on weapons show wear, reinforcing your progression as you upgrade gear.

The UI strikes a balance between functionality and ambiance. Hotbars, party windows, and chat boxes are neatly arranged without obstructing the view, allowing you to appreciate the world design. Customizable HUD elements let seasoned players streamline on‐screen information, keeping the interface as unobtrusive as possible during intense sieges or PvP skirmishes.

Story

Set as a prequel to the original Lineage, The Chaotic Chronicle explores the early days of the three kingdoms—Aden, Elmore, and Gracia—long before the familiar Blood Pledge conflicts. Rich lore is woven into every region, with NPC dialogues, in‐game journals, and environmental storytelling all contributing to a cohesive narrative tapestry.

Your journey unfolds through both main story quests and a plethora of side missions, each revealing layers of political intrigue and ancient rivalries. As you align with different factions, you’ll uncover hints of the eventual descent into chaos, foreshadowing the events that shape the wider Lineage universe.

The narrative pacing is commendable: initial quests ease you into the mechanics, while mid‐game story arcs escalate tensions between kingdoms, culminating in large‐scale events like clan sieges. This structure ensures that the storyline remains compelling, driving you forward from humble beginnings as a novice adventurer to a key player in kingdom‐wide power struggles.

Overall Experience

Lineage II: The Chaotic Chronicle excels at combining large‐scale warfare with solo and small‐group content, offering something for both PvP enthusiasts and PvE fans. The synergy between real‐time combat, clan politics, and creature taming creates a multi‐faceted gameplay loop that keeps players engaged over the long haul. Whether you’re storming castle walls with dozens of allies or hunting rare beasts in remote forests, there’s always a fresh goal on the horizon.

However, the learning curve can be steep. Newcomers may find the plethora of systems—class branching, clan mechanics, crafting, and pet management—overwhelming at first. Fortunately, robust online communities and in‐game guides help smooth the ramp, and alliances with veteran players often prove invaluable during early levels.

Ultimately, The Chaotic Chronicle stands as a testament to classic MMORPG design done right. Its enduring appeal lies in the interplay between personal progression and collective conquest. For those seeking an immersive fantasy world where every alliance and victory feels earned, Lineage II offers a richly detailed, ever‐evolving playground worth exploring.
